HRtechnology has been advancing since the 1950s, starting with the first computerized systems to assist with payroll. In the late 1980s, the first HRMS (HR management system) was introduced, followed by the LMS (learning management system) and job boards in the 1990s. Contents What is HRtechnology?

The first step in solving most problems is figuring out what’s took place – that’s descriptive analytics. DIAGNOSTIC analytics answer the question “why did it happen?”.
